推荐阅读:
[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024
[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E
[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务
[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台
本文详细介绍了在Ubuntu系统中安装phpMyAdMin的方法,包括安装PHP环境,以及phpMyAdmin的具体步骤,旨在帮助用户轻松搭建PHP开发环境,实现数据库的便捷管理。
本文目录导读:
Ubuntu系统作为一款流行的开源操作系统,其稳定性和安全性受到了广大开发者和用户的青睐,本文将为您详细介绍如何在Ubuntu系统上安装phpMyAdmin,让您轻松管理MySQL数据库。
准备工作
1、确保您的Ubuntu系统已更新到最新版本,执行以下命令:
```
sudo apt update
sudo apt upgrade
```
2、安装MySQL数据库:
```
sudo apt install mysql-server
```
3、安装PHP环境(如果您还没有安装):
```
sudo apt install php
sudo apt install php-mysql
```
安装phpMyAdmin
1、添加phpMyAdmin的ppa源:
```
sudo add-apt-rePOSitory ppa:phpmyadmin/ppa
```
2、更新源并安装phpMyAdmin:
```
sudo apt update
sudo apt install phpmyadmin
```
3、在安装过程中,系统会提示您选择Web服务器,这里我们选择Apache2:
```
Apache2
```
4、系统会提示您输入MySQL root用户的密码,输入后按回车继续:
```
输入MySQL root用户的密码
```
5、安装完成后,启动Apache2服务:
```
sudo systemctl start apache2
```
6、打开浏览器,输入以下地址访问phpMyAdmin:
```
http://localhost/phpmyadmin
```
配置phpMyAdmin
1、为了让phpMyAdmin更加易用,我们可以进行一些简单的配置,备份默认的配置文件:
```
sudo cp /etc/phpmyadmin/config.inc.php /etc/phpmyadmin/config.inc.php.bak
```
2、打开配置文件:
```
sudo nano /etc/phpmyadmin/config.inc.php
```
3、在配置文件中,找到以下代码:
```
$cfg['Servers'][$i]['auth_type'] = 'cookie';
```
将其修改为:
```
$cfg['Servers'][$i]['auth_type'] = 'config';
```
4、在同一文件中,找到以下代码:
```
$cfg['Servers'][$i]['user'] = 'root';
$cfg['Servers'][$i]['password'] = 'your_mysql_root_password';
```
将其中的your_mysql_root_password
替换为您的MySQL root用户密码。
5、保存并关闭配置文件。
6、重启Apache2服务:
```
sudo systemctl restart apache2
```
注意事项
1、请确保您的防火墙已开放80端口,以便外部访问Apache2服务。
2、如果您使用的是Nginx作为Web服务器,请按照以下步骤进行配置:
a. 创建一个新的Nginx配置文件:
```
sudo nano /etc/nginx/sites-available/phpmyadmin
```
b. 添加以下内容:
```
server {
listen 80;
server_name your_server_ip;
location / {
proxy_pass http://localhost/phpmyadmin;
proxy_set_header Host $host;
proxy_set_header X-Real-IP $remote_addr;
pro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
proxy_set_header X-Forwarded-Proto $scheme;
}
}
```
c. 链接配置文件到启用目录:
```
sudo ln -s /etc/nginx/sites-available/phpmyadmin /etc/nginx/sites-enabled/
```
d. 重启Nginx服务:
```
sudo systemctl restart nginx
```
3、如果您在使用过程中遇到问题,可以查看官方文档或寻求社区帮助。
通过本文的介绍,您已经学会了如何在Ubuntu系统上安装和配置phpMyAdmin,您可以轻松地通过Web界面管理MySQL数据库,提高工作效率。
以下是50个中文相关关键词:
Ubuntu, phpMyAdmin, 安装, MySQL, 数据库, Apache2, Nginx, Web服务器, 配置, 防火墙, 端口, ppa源, 更新, 升级, 备份, 配置文件, 重启, 防火墙规则, 虚拟主机, 服务器, IP地址, 代理, 请求头, 社区, 帮助, 文档, 指南, 教程, 步骤, 操作, 技巧, 经验, 问题解决, 安全性, 稳定性, 开源, 开发者, 用户, 便捷性, 界面, 功能, 数据库管理, 高效, 易用, 优化, 网络安全, 数据保护, 权限控制
本文标签属性:
Ubuntu phpMyAdmin 安装:ubuntu安装php环境